Julie Dillon (born 1982) is an American freelance artist. She was the cover artist for the first issue of A Soar of Eagles, a prequel comic to the 2023 game Assassin's Creed: Mirage.

Early life and career[edit | edit source]

Dillon earned a Bachelor of Fine Arts from Sacramento State University in 2005. She furthered her education at the Academy of Art University in San Francisco and Watts Atelier.[1] She began working as a professional artist in 2006 and has since made artwork for Magic: The Gathering, among others.[2]

Assassin's Creed[edit | edit source]

In March 2024, Dillon was announced as the cover artist of the upcoming first issue of the prequel comic to the 2023 video game Assassin's Creed: Mirage, to be titled A Soar of Eagles and focus on the Master Assassin Fuladh Al Haami, in his youth many years prior to the video game. The comic was written by Michael Avon Oeming with art by Mirko Colak.[3]
